Quick view Choose Options BTS Towels Hydro Opulence Bath Towels Price: Price: Price: Sale Price: $9.50 - $79.00
Quick view Choose Options Margo Selby Tankerton Towels Price: Price: Price: Sale Price: $37.00 - $97.00
Quick view Choose Options Margo Selby Seasalter Towels Price: Price: Price: Sale Price: $37.00 - $97.00
Quick view Choose Options Margo Selby Eastbourne towels Price: Price: Price: Sale Price: $37.00 - $97.00
Quick view Choose Options Sorema Pearls Bath Towels Price: Price: Price: Sale Price: $33.00 - $159.00